necromania

 

Definitions from WordNet

Noun necromania has 1 sense
  1. necrophilia, necrophilism, necromania - an irresistible sexual attraction to dead bodies
    --1 is a kind of mania, passion, cacoethes

Definitions from the Web

necromania

Part of speech: Noun

Sense: An abnormal fascination or obsession with death or the dead.

Usage:

  1. She had a morbid necromania, constantly visiting cemeteries and studying funeral rituals.
  2. His collection of human skulls revealed his necromania.

Part of speech: Noun

Sense: A psychiatric disorder characterized by sexual attraction toward dead bodies.

Usage:

  1. The protagonist in the horror movie suffered from necromania, causing him to seek out recently deceased individuals.
  2. The psychologist specialized in treating patients with necromania, helping them overcome their disturbing desires.
